Transaction d63c2f1897cc75ccb8c9b2d6b0669098e1816a511e24d9f119f1bc6bda068388

1 Input
2 Outputs
  • d63c2f1897cc75ccb8c9b2d6b0669098e1816a511e24d9f119f1bc6bda068388:0
  • value  40376168
    address  1Mw1nBeG3VbCxTCgj9KEYJJLiwxGgRrQKF
  • d63c2f1897cc75ccb8c9b2d6b0669098e1816a511e24d9f119f1bc6bda068388:1
  • value  2217547
    address  36sGAKTrPJRMY2FCFeMfaE6nP4eDCHBbPU